About Bo
• Boaz was born on February 18, 1959, at Afula Hospital in Israel
• He is the second of three children born to Esther and the late Sasson Itshaky, who raised him in kibbutz Ramot Menashe
• After completing his military service in the late 70’s, Bo traveled extensively around the world. He spent most of the 1980s in Switzerland before moving in 1989 to his current residency in Bethany
• Boaz has completed his Master of Science in Oriental Medicine (MSOM) from the Tri-State College of Acupuncture (New York, NY) in 2004 and is currently practicing in Orange and Cheshire
• In 2005, he ran as an independent for First Selectman in Bethany
• In 2006, he became a member of the Bethany Republican Town Committee and ran on the Republican line for Connecticut’s State Senate 17th District.
• In 2006, he ran for CT State Senate – 17th District
• In 2007, Bo was elected to represent the 17th State Senatorial District on the Connecticut Republican State Central Committee
• In 2008, he ran for US House of Representatives – Connecticut’s 3rd District
